Y1 - 1909/08/14 N1 - 10.1001/jama.1909.02550070090025 JO - Journal of the American Medical Association SP - 586 EP - 586 VL - LIII IS - 7 N2 - This book, while including subjects of interest to the general student of embryology, is primarily intended "to present to the student of medicine the most important facts of development, at the same time emphasizing those features which bear directly on other branches of medicine." It is accordingly divided into two parts and an appendix. Part I deals with general development. Part II with the development of the adult tissues and organs. To each chapter there is appended a good bibliography and "practical suggestions" for laboratory work, embracing the subjects dealt with in that chapter. In each chapter of Part II there is added under "anomalies" an embryologic consideration of malformations peculiar to the structures taken up in the respective chapter.
